How they compare
Indonesia currently reports -52.31 % change on previous year against -54.55 % change on previous year in Niger, a difference of 2.24 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 10 times across 16 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Indonesia ahead.
Indonesia ranks 97th and Niger ranks 99th of 148 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Indonesia averaged higher in 4 and Niger in 2.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Arms imports (SIPRI trend indicator values).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
